在MATLAB 2017a中安装MinGW64编译器后,如何配置环境变量以实现与MATLAB的无缝集成?
时间: 2024-11-01 20:13:56 浏览: 9
安装MinGW64编译器之后,为了使其与MATLAB 2017a正确集成,需要配置系统环境变量以让MATLAB识别到编译器的位置。以下是详细步骤,这部分内容与资料《MATLAB 2017a配置MinGW64编译器指南》紧密相关,将引导你完成这一过程。
参考资源链接:[MATLAB 2017a配置MinGW64编译器指南](https://wenku.csdn.net/doc/4dfezq0kps?spm=1055.2569.3001.10343)
首先,在Windows 7系统中,你需要通过控制面板中的系统属性来设置环境变量。具体操作步骤如下:
1. 右键点击“计算机”图标,选择“属性”进入系统属性。
2. 点击“高级系统设置”,打开系统属性对话框。
3. 在“系统属性”窗口的“高级”选项卡下,点击“环境变量”按钮。
4. 在“环境变量”对话框中,找到“系统变量”区域并点击“新建”。
5. 创建一个新的系统变量,变量名设置为`MW_MINGW64_LOC`,变量值填写MinGW64的安装路径,例如`C:\TDM-GCC-64`。
完成以上设置后,打开MATLAB 2017a,进入命令窗口,输入`setenv('MW_MINGW64_LOC','C:\TDM-GCC-64')`来在MATLAB中设置临时环境变量,确保当前会话能够找到MinGW64编译器。
最后,通过输入命令`mex -setup`,启动MATLAB的编译器选择向导。在出现的列表中选择MinGW64Compiler作为默认的C语言编译器,并按照向导提示完成配置。
如果你希望避免每次打开MATLAB时都手动设置环境变量,可以将`MW_MINGW64_LOC`变量添加到系统环境变量中。这样,MATLAB每次启动时都能自动找到MinGW64编译器的位置,实现无干扰的集成使用。为了深入理解这些步骤及其背后的原理,建议详细阅读《MATLAB 2017a配置MinGW64编译器指南》,它将为你提供更全面的信息和额外的配置细节。
参考资源链接:[MATLAB 2017a配置MinGW64编译器指南](https://wenku.csdn.net/doc/4dfezq0kps?spm=1055.2569.3001.10343)
阅读全文